The Magnificent Magnesium

First up, we’ve got Magnesium. This stuff is like the Swiss Army knife of supplements. Seriously, it's involved in hundreds of bodily processes. You might be thinking, "Magnesium? Sounds boring." But trust me, when you're on Tirzepatide, things can get a little…ahemintestinal. Magnesium can help regulate that, shall we say, "digestive flow."

Plus, Tirzepatide can sometimes lead to dehydration. Magnesium helps with electrolyte balance, which is crucial when you're essentially turning your body into a highly efficient fat-burning machine. Think of it as adding premium fuel to your already souped-up engine! Word to the wise: start slow. Too much magnesium, and you might be spending more time in the bathroom than you planned. Nobody wants that kind of "cleanse."

The Protein Power-Up

Next, let’s talk about Protein. Now, I know what you’re thinking: "Protein? Groundbreaking." But bear with me. Tirzepatide works by slowing down gastric emptying, meaning you feel fuller for longer. This is fantastic for portion control, but it also means you need to prioritize quality nutrients. Protein is essential for preserving muscle mass, which is super important when you're losing weight. We want to burn fat, not our precious biceps, right?

Aim for lean protein sources like chicken, fish, tofu, or a high-quality protein powder. And here's a pro tip: protein shakes can be a lifesaver when you're feeling nauseous, a side effect some people experience with Tirzepatide. Sipping on a protein shake is much easier than forcing down a chicken breast when your stomach is doing the tango. Plus, it’s like a secret weapon against hanger. The Fiber Frenzy

Ah, Fiber. The unsung hero of gut health. Tirzepatide can sometimes cause constipation, and fiber is your knight in shining armor (or, you know, your trusty plumber). Think of it as a tiny army of scrub brushes, keeping everything moving smoothly through your digestive system. Not the most glamorous analogy, I know, but hey, it's effective!

Increase your fiber intake gradually to avoid any…unpleasant surprises. Think psyllium husk, chia seeds, flaxseed, and plenty of fruits and vegetables. Just picture yourself as a well-oiled machine, fueled by fiber and ready to conquer the world (or at least fit into those skinny jeans you've been eyeing).

The Vitamin Voyage

Don't forget your Vitamins! A good multivitamin can help fill any nutritional gaps that might arise while you're on Tirzepatide. Especially important are Vitamin D, B vitamins, and iron. Tirzepatide can affect your appetite, and while that's great for weight loss, it also means you might not be getting all the nutrients you need from food alone. Consider it a nutritional insurance policy.

Do you know that feeling when you eat something and it tastes off? That can happen when you're deficient in some vitamins. Get your levels tested and supplement accordingly. It is also advisable to take a B12 supplement. Some people who take tirzepatide complain about not having enough energy. B12 can help!

The Hydration Hero

Okay, okay, I know water isn’t technically a supplement, but it's arguably the most important thing on this list. Hydration is absolutely crucial when you're taking Tirzepatide. Water helps with everything from digestion to energy levels to, well, just about everything! Aim for at least eight glasses of water a day, and even more if you're exercising.

Carry a water bottle with you everywhere you go and make it your constant companion. Think of it as your personal hydration cheerleader, reminding you to drink up and stay awesome. You can even infuse your water with fruits and herbs for a little extra flavor boost. Cucumber and mint, anyone?
